When to move down in stakes?

Hi!
I have been consistently beating 5nl(4nl cuz euros) on MPN network and now i have 220 dollars and wanna try 10nl.
It is 22 buy ins.
If the taking shots goes bad when should i move down in stakes at 130 dollars?
Thanks for advice

You could take 1 or 2 buy-in shots while also playing 5nl, mixing the tables together. Losing 9 buyins seems like too far to move back down, maybe move back down if you lose 3-4, or whatever you're comfortable with.

I would drop down very quickly if you hit a downswing of 3 buy ins, for me personally I hate losing 1/2 my bankroll and this would represent a problem for me. Also I think it's good practice to move down and get used to doing this. It's annoying but important skill to develop that will serve you well on your way up the stake levels. Once it's rebuilt have another go. Also try to pick good times to move up to maximise your chances of success.

One mistake I made for years (and still make sometimes) is focussing on moving up quick and taking shots. The problem with this is that it often messes with your mindset if it goes wrong (imagine losing half your roll) and it will cause you to study less efficient.

So my advice: study twice as much as you play and make sure you do this efficient, take a 5BI shot at $300.

I recently moved up playing 1 table of 10nl zoom for 30minutes, then added a table of 5nl zoom on top for the remainder of the session. May be worth trying to add in tables of the stake above, if the bet sizing wont be too difficult.

Also check what day of the week you have the best ev bb/100 amd take your shots then

Ill probably do the same again with 16nl or 25nl - max 3buyins

Ps. Ive found the stake above easier but its. Only been 7500 hands
